Formula: Fluid Dram (US) to Milliliter
To convert from fluid dram (us) to milliliter, multiply the value in fluid dram (us) by the conversion factor 3.696691. The result is the equivalent value in milliliter.

How to Convert Fluid Dram (US) to Milliliter
The conversion from fluid dram (us) to milliliter follows a straightforward mathematical process. Take your value in fluid dram (us), and multiply it by the conversion factor of 3.696691. For example, to convert 5 fl dr to mL, calculate 5 × 3.696691. This formula works for any value — whether you are converting small decimal values or very large numbers. For the reverse conversion (milliliter to fluid dram (us)), simply divide by the same factor, or equivalently, multiply by the reciprocal.
